Tim Ferriss offers a variety of recommendations across different media and topics. Here are some specific recommendations:
-
Films: Ferriss recommends the movie "Fitzgeraldo" by Werner Herzog and the Australian comedy "Bad Boy Bubby" from 1993 1.
-
Audiobooks: He highly endorses "The Graveyard Book" by Neil Gaiman and "Vagabonding" by Ralph Potts, both available on Audible. These books have significantly impacted his life and professional approach 2.
-
Books: If asked to recommend one of his books, Ferriss would suggest "Tools of Titans". He believes this book has something for everyone and would appeal to the most significant number of people 3.
-
Documentaries: Ferriss praises the documentaries "Bigger, Stronger, Faster" and "Prescription Thugs". These films provide insights into performance-enhancing drugs and are made by the brother of Mark Bell, a guest on his show 4.
